DECK 10

Deck 10 houses the photon torpedo launching system. This facility handles the storage, arming and loading of the ship's photon torpedoes. All loading and firing procedures are handled from the bridge; this arrangement shortens firing order-to-launch time by twenty percent over common manual launch systems. Storage for the torpedo casings is also on Deck 10. A loading arm magnetically clutches each casing to be fired and inserts it into an arming receptacle, where a matter/antimatter charge is injected and primed. Once the explosive payload is in place, the casing travels to the launch system. There, the loading arm releases the armed torpedo, and it is carried into the launch tube by magnetic carrier.

The photon torpedo launch tube is mounted on the primary hull's forward centerline, in between the forward phaser banks.

The ship's Auxiliary Fire Control Room is situated at the center of the Deck. From this location, all shipboard weapons systems can be controlled manually.
